Recently, the House State-Foreign Operations Subcommittee voted to reinstate the "gag bill" which prohibits U.S. funding to international health care providers who advocate for abortion rights.

The gag rule impedes the ability of doctors to help their patients by preventing patients from receiving the care and guidance they need. Many international medical centers that support abortion rights also play a vital role in disease prevention. By disallowing funding to these medical centers it endangers a wide range of people who rely on them for reasons that go beyond seeking abortions

The reinstatement of the bill, along with further cuts the Subcommittee passed, is projected to increase the number of abortions by 1.3 million rather than decrease it. Many of these abortions will not be performed under safe conditions.
